My husband and I went for dinner last night and were completely happy from start to finish! We are so glad we decided to go to Iron Vine! Our waitress, Ali, was fabulous. She answered every question and was on point every time. She recommended the El Cocodrillo, a house cocktail, made with in-house infused jalapeño tequila. Absolutely delicious! We had seafood empanadas and croquettas de chorizo for appetizers. Both were delicious! You can tell immediately that the empanadas are homemade and fresh. The seafood filling(crab & conch) inside was excellent. Both the crab and the conch were fresh and not imitation. The croquettas were amazing. Filled with chorizo, potatoes and manchego and deep fried with a mango chutney sauce. Perfect! The chutney was spicy but not over done and paired perfectly. I had the El Jibarito(skirt steak) sandwich for dinner and my husband the Cubano. I’m not a huge fan of of plantains and the El Jibarito is served on plantain tostadas so I asked if it was possible to get the sandwich on something else. Again, our waitress Ali, explained that the skirt steak is served whole so it’s hard to put it on a roll. She said it could be done but assured me that the plantain tostadas were the perfect pairing for the sandwich, made fresh and cooked perfectly. She was 100% correct! I absolutely loved every bite. My steak was cooked to perfect rare from end to end and the meat was tender. Usually when you bite into a steak sandwich it’s hard to get a bite but you wouldn’t even know you were biting into a steak sandwich the meat was that tender. My husband loved every bite of his Cubano, hand made fries and homemade ketchup. The menu is small but that is the best part! Every dish is made fresh daily and all local. Absolutely delicious!!! I would rather have a restaurant that has«limited choices» so that the focus is on quality ingredients, cooking and taste rather than quantity. Fabulous service, amazing food, beautifully decorated and very enjoyable! Thank you Iron Vine for a fabulous meal and experience! We can’t wait to come back!
